MUSIC, fun, dance and laughter were the patrons' lot at the Link Theatre's Nifty Fifties musical.
The show was fast moving, colourful and performed successfully with great enthusiasm.
Northam theatre patrons have once again supported the Theatre Group for its last musical production this year, and were rewarded with an obviously well rehearsed cast, wanting to entertain, and to have fun themselves.
Both character acting, and confident singing from the new, young, talented and committed actors and actresses who gave audiences such an excellent show as the Fifties, means we can expect some exciting theatre in 2015.
The music, the rock n' roll and the Beatniks brought back youthful memories for many audience members.
The atmosphere in the Link was exciting and colourful, due to the many excellent performances by individual characters and members of the chorus.
The harmony songs hit the right note with rounds of applause from the near-full houses.
The dancing routines were evidence of the hours of practice and effort put in by the 22 cast members.
On display in the foyer of the theatre were photographs showing the retractable seating the group plans to install in the auditorium
Fundraising is progressing, but offers of sponsorship and/or donations are welcome.
The committee is working hard to secure grants and has set its sights on having the project completed early next year.
